Futures options work the same as regular options, except that 1 futures option exercises into a 1 futures contract position. The futures options trading hours are the same as the underlying futures markets, which in most cases is 23x5. For a day trade of a standard Gold Futures (GC) contract, you need $2,000 in your account, plus additional funds to accommodate potential losses. The amount required by your broker to open a day trading position is called "intra-day margin." It varies by the broker and is subject to change.

No trades in Corn futures deliverable in the current month shall be made after the business day preceding the 15th calendar day of that month. Futures can be traded with over 30x leverage and are risky because of that leverage.Crude Oil Futures are quoted in dollars and cents per barrel. Minimum Price Fluctuation: $0.01 (1¢) per barrel ($10 per contract). Futures: Initial limits of $3.00 per barrel are in place in all but the first two months and rise to $6.00 per barrel if the previous day's settlement price in any back month is at the $3.00 limit. E-Mini S&P 500 futures (ES) are an excellent middle ground and a good place for day traders to start.Margins are low at $500, and volume is also slightly higher than crude oil. Holding a single contract through a typical trading day could see your profit/loss take a $7,518 swing (150.63 points x $50/point). An equity trader can only trade up to four times their maintenance margin excess on an intra-day basis. So if they have $30,000 maintenance excess available, they can only trade up to a value of $120,000. Exceed this amount and margin calls may further limit buying power and trading frequency. Futures exchanges generally impose ‘price movement limits’ on most futures contracts. For instance, the daily price movement limit on orange juice futures contract on the New York Board of Trade is 5 cents per pound or $750 per contract (which covers 15,000 pounds).
